Markel restructures underwriting department

Company reshapes division as it looks to create new products and add to profitability

Specialist insurance company Markel International is looking to boost its profitability and add to its product line-up with a shake-up of its underwriting department in Spain.

The department will now be split into two main business areas: personal accident and liability.

Meanwhile, personal accident will continue to be led by Luis Bodaño and the liability area will be led by Adrián Benito, who has been appointed liability manager.   

In his new role, Adrián will be in charge of reinforcing the liability underwriting function by creating new products as well as developing the business in a profitable and efficient manner.

Adrián has over 20 years’ experience in the Spanish insurance sector. He started his career in the sales department of Plus Ultra and later moved to the liability department. In 2001, he joined Reale Seguros as liability manager with the objective of developing the liability lines. He later joined WR Berkley in 2012 as underwriting manager, covering professional indemnity, D&O and general liability, a position he held until June 2016.       

Adrián has a BA degree in Economics & Business Studies from the Complutense University of Madrid and has a Master in Management of Insurance Companies by ICEA.
